I liked Linus' comments. They essentially echo the arguments for XP, that software should be evolved rather than Designed (captial-D). Even though he was (apparently) talking about Solaris when critisizing Sun, the same argument indicts the acolytes of the Java Community Process as well. As a case in point, I would like to point out EJB CMP as an example of "design-driven" technology which may very well look really stupid in another few years, especially given its atrociously slow mutation rate. If anyone who was writing this crap (the spec) was actually *using* it, it would probably allow for automatic generation of freaking primary keys...
